1. What Happens to Teeth During Invisalign Treatment?

Invisalign treatment involves a series of clear aligners that gradually shift teeth into proper alignment. Each aligner is worn for about two weeks before transitioning to the next. This process applies controlled pressure on teeth, promoting movement.

2. Do Teeth Become Weak After Treatment?

Concerns regarding teeth weakness post-Invisalign treatment are valid. However, evidence suggests that teeth do not inherently become weak. Instead, proper oral care post-treatment is crucial.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Will my teeth shift after Invisalign treatment?

Teeth may shift without proper retainer use. Retainers help maintain alignment.

2. How long should I wear my retainer after treatment?

Initially, wear retainers full-time for at least 3 months. Gradually transition to nighttime only.

3. Can I eat with my Invisalign aligners in?

No, aligners should be removed during meals to avoid damage and staining.

4. What happens if I don’t wear my retainer?

Not wearing retainers increases the risk of teeth shifting back to their original positions.

5. Should I avoid any foods after Invisalign treatment?

Avoid hard and sticky foods to protect teeth and dental work. Maintain a balanced diet for optimal dental health.
